Understanding Boba Vending Machines

What is a Boba Vending Machine?

A boba vending machine is an automated kiosk specifically designed to prepare and serve bubble tea. These machines mix tea, milk, flavorings, and tapioca pearls, offering a customizable experience in a fraction of the time it takes to order from a traditional boba shop. Types of Boba Vending Machines

  1. Automated Kiosks: These machines offer a streamlined process for customers, providing a touchscreen interface to customize drinks. They are typically found in high-traffic areas such as malls and corporate offices.

  2. Robotic Baristas: Utilizing advanced robotics, these machines can prepare complex drinks and even cook tapioca pearls on demand. This type of machine is often used in airports or universities where speed and quality are paramount.

  3. Standard Vending Machines: These traditional models offer a limited selection of boba drinks with minimal customization. Ideal for convenience stores and gyms, they serve as an entry point for vendors looking to offer boba without high investment.

  4. Specialty Kiosks: Partnering with established brands, these machines provide unique flavors and premium ingredients. Events and food festivals are perfect venues for these offerings.

How Boba Vending Machines Work

The Technology Behind the Machines

Boba vending machines utilize a combination of robotics, touchscreen interfaces, and automated dispensing systems. Users can select their desired drink options through a user-friendly touchscreen, which then signals the machine to prepare the drink. Ingredients such as tea, milk, and flavoring are dispensed in precise quantities, ensuring consistency and quality.

Customization Options

Customization is a key feature of boba vending machines. Customers can choose from various tea bases, flavors, sweetness levels, and toppings. This level of personalization is what sets these machines apart from traditional vending options. Advantages of Boba Vending Machines

Convenience and Speed

One of the most significant advantages of boba vending machines is the speed at which drinks can be prepared. Most machines can produce a drink in under two minutes, drastically reducing wait times for customers. This convenience appeals to busy consumers who seek quick refreshment.

24/7 Availability

Unlike traditional boba shops that have limited hours, vending machines can operate 24/7, catering to customers’ cravings at any time of day or night. This advantage is particularly beneficial in locations like college campuses or corporate offices, where late-night snacking is common.

Low Operational Costs

Boba vending machines generally require less staff than traditional shops, lowering operational costs. This aspect makes it an attractive investment for entrepreneurs and businesses looking to expand their beverage offerings.

Market Trends and Consumer Demand

Growing Popularity of Bubble Tea

The market for bubble tea is projected to grow significantly, with estimates suggesting an increase from $5.3 billion to $8.7 billion globally by 2024. This growth creates a promising landscape for boba vending machines, as they offer a solution to meet increasing consumer demand efficiently.

Target Demographics

Boba tea appeals primarily to younger demographics, particularly millennials and Gen Z. These consumers value unique flavors and experiences, making customizable vending machines an appealing option.
